BIOGRAPHY

Moses Akampurira is the Chair of the African Blood Regulatory Technical Committee (ABR-TC), established under the African Medicines Regulatory Harmonisation (AMRH) programme. In this role, he provides strategic leadership in strengthening regulatory systems for blood products across Africa. His work within the ABR-TC focuses on developing harmonised regulatory frameworks, promoting quality and safety standards, and building capacity among national regulatory authorities to ensure equitable access to safe blood and blood products. Moses also serves as a Senior Inspector of Drugs with the Uganda National Drug Authority (NDA), where he leads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P) inspections and provides technical expertise in the regulatory oversight of biological medicines, including vaccines, blood products, and other biotherapeutics. A pharmacist by profession, Moses holds postgraduate qualifications in immunology and vaccinology. His work bridges science, policy, and regulation, contributing to improved health emergency preparedness and advancing the continent’s goal of strengthening local pharmaceutical manufacturing.
